Output 8506fba1dda4a30ad446c4810ed93cfb6f53df3b3c6df06f8886d7a4594de210:0

value
520920
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 267a035168075718614ee0aa44d73d2ed840a3d3 OP_EQUALVERIFY OP_CHECKSIG
address
14WSqu8EfbP17sv3aH3SggwuXBqgAs98wW
transaction
8506fba1dda4a30ad446c4810ed93cfb6f53df3b3c6df06f8886d7a4594de210
confirmations
403760
spent
true